版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2025年春招试卷及答案江苏
姓名:__________考号:__________一、单选题(共10题)1.以下哪个是HTML5中用于定义多媒体内容的标签?()A.<audio>B.<video>C.<media>D.<multimedia>2.在Python中,以下哪个不是内置的数据类型?()A.intB.floatC.listD.string3.以下哪个是CSS中用于设置元素边框样式的属性?()A.border-colorB.border-styleC.border-widthD.all4.在JavaScript中,以下哪个是全局对象?()A.MathB.DateC.ArrayD.Function5.以下哪个是SQL中用于创建表的语句?()A.CREATETABLEB.INSERTINTOC.SELECTD.UPDATE6.以下哪个是Java中的基本数据类型?()A.StringB.IntegerC.ObjectD.boolean7.以下哪个是Linux中的文件权限表示方法?()A.rwxr-xr-xB.read-onlyC.write-onlyD.execute-only8.以下哪个是Python中的异常处理关键字?()A.tryB.catchC.throwD.finally9.以下哪个是HTTP协议中的请求方法?()A.GETB.POSTC.PUTD.DELETE10.以下哪个是JavaScript中的事件处理程序属性?()A.onclickB.onmouseoverC.onchangeD.all二、多选题(共5题)11.在Java中,以下哪些是面向对象编程的基本特征?()A.封装B.继承C.多态D.过程化12.以下哪些是SQL数据库中常用的聚合函数?()A.SUMB.AVGC.COUNTD.DISTINCT13.以下哪些是Linux操作系统中常见的文件权限类型?()A.读(r)B.写(w)C.执行(x)D.拥有者(o)14.以下哪些是Python中的内置数据类型?()A.intB.floatC.listD.string15.以下哪些是HTTP协议中的请求方法?()A.GETB.POSTC.PUTD.DELETE三、填空题(共5题)16.HTML5中用于定义文档类型的声明是________。17.Python中,将一个整数转换为字符串的函数是________。18.在CSS中,设置元素字体大小的属性是________。19.SQL中,用于选择所有记录的查询语句是________。20.在JavaScript中,用于获取元素ID的属性是________。四、判断题(共5题)21.CSS中的float属性可以用来清除浮动。()A.正确B.错误22.在Python中,所有的数字类型都是内置数据类型。()A.正确B.错误23.JavaScript中的全局对象window包含了所有的DOM元素。()A.正确B.错误24.SQL中的JOIN操作总是返回两个表的所有行。()A.正确B.错误25.在Linux中,使用chmod命令可以改变文件的所有者。()A.正确B.错误五、简单题(共5题)26.简述HTTP协议的工作原理。27.解释在Python中如何使用类和对象实现封装。28.描述SQL数据库中索引的作用和类型。29.说明在Linux系统中如何使用pip进行Python包的安装。30.阐述在JavaScript中如何使用事件监听器来处理用户交互。
2025年春招试卷及答案江苏一、单选题(共10题)1.【答案】B【解析】HTML5中用于定义多媒体内容的标签是<video>,它允许在网页中嵌入视频内容。2.【答案】C【解析】在Python中,int、float和string都是内置的数据类型,而list是一个容器数据类型,不是内置的数据类型。3.【答案】D【解析】在CSS中,border属性可以同时设置边框的颜色、样式和宽度,使用'border'属性可以一次性设置所有边框样式。4.【答案】A【解析】在JavaScript中,Math是一个内置对象,提供数学运算的方法和值,它是全局对象的一部分。5.【答案】A【解析】在SQL中,CREATETABLE语句用于创建一个新的表。6.【答案】D【解析】在Java中,boolean是基本数据类型之一,用于表示布尔值。7.【答案】A【解析】在Linux中,文件权限通常使用rwxr-xr-x这样的格式表示,其中r代表读权限,w代表写权限,x代表执行权限。8.【答案】A【解析】在Python中,try用于尝试执行可能引发异常的代码块,catch和throw不是Python的关键字,finally用于确保代码块无论是否发生异常都会执行。9.【答案】A【解析】在HTTP协议中,GET是用于请求数据的请求方法,它通常用于获取服务器上的资源。10.【答案】D【解析】在JavaScript中,onclick、onmouseover和onchange都是事件处理程序属性,用于处理不同类型的事件。二、多选题(共5题)11.【答案】ABC【解析】Java的面向对象编程具有封装、继承和多态三个基本特征,而过程化不是面向对象编程的特征。12.【答案】ABC【解析】SQL数据库中常用的聚合函数包括SUM(求和)、AVG(平均值)和COUNT(计数),DISTINCT是用于选择唯一值的函数,不是聚合函数。13.【答案】ABC【解析】Linux操作系统中,文件权限类型包括读(r)、写(w)和执行(x),而拥有者(o)是权限的归属,不是权限类型。14.【答案】ABCD【解析】Python中的内置数据类型包括整数(int)、浮点数(float)、列表(list)和字符串(string)。15.【答案】ABCD【解析】HTTP协议中的请求方法包括GET、POST、PUT和DELETE,这些方法用于指定客户端向服务器发送请求的目的。三、填空题(共5题)16.【答案】!DOCTYPEhtml【解析】在HTML5中,文档类型声明(DOCTYPE)是<!DOCTYPEhtml>,它告诉浏览器文档是HTML5格式。17.【答案】str()【解析】Python中的str()函数可以将不同的数据类型转换为字符串类型,包括整数。18.【答案】font-size【解析】在CSS中,font-size属性用于设置元素的字体大小,可以接受像素值、em值或百分比等。19.【答案】SELECT*FROM表名【解析】在SQL中,SELECT*FROM表名是选择表中所有记录的基本查询语句,星号(*)代表所有列。20.【答案】getElementById【解析】在JavaScript中,getElementById方法用于通过元素的ID获取DOM元素,是DOM操作中常用的一种方法。四、判断题(共5题)21.【答案】错误【解析】CSS中的float属性用于控制元素的浮动,而clear属性是用来清除浮动影响的。22.【答案】正确【解析】Python中的数字类型,如int、float、complex等,都是内置数据类型。23.【答案】错误【解析】JavaScript中的window对象是浏览器窗口的全局对象,但并不是所有的DOM元素都包含在window对象中。24.【答案】错误【解析】SQL中的JOIN操作根据指定的条件连接两个或多个表,并不总是返回两个表的所有行,而是根据连接条件返回匹配的行。25.【答案】错误【解析】在Linux中,使用chmod命令可以改变文件或目录的权限,但不是用来改变所有者的。改变所有者通常使用chown命令。五、简答题(共5题)26.【答案】HTTP协议(超文本传输协议)是一种应用层协议,用于在Web浏览器和Web服务器之间传输数据。工作原理如下:客户端(通常是浏览器)通过HTTP请求向服务器发送请求,服务器接收到请求后,根据请求的内容进行处理,并将处理结果以HTTP响应的形式返回给客户端。这个过程包括请求的发送、服务器处理请求、发送响应以及客户端接收响应等步骤。【解析】HTTP协议的工作原理涉及客户端和服务器之间的交互,理解其基本流程对于开发Web应用程序至关重要。27.【答案】在Python中,封装是通过定义类和对象来实现的。类是对象的蓝图,它包含数据和操作这些数据的方法。封装意味着将数据隐藏在类的内部,并通过公共接口(即方法)来访问这些数据。要实现封装,可以采用以下步骤:
1.定义一个类,包含私有属性和方法。
2.通过公有的方法提供对私有属性的访问和修改。
3.使用单下划线(_)或双下划线(__)来标识私有属性和方法,以防止外部直接访问。【解析】封装是面向对象编程的一个重要原则,它有助于保护类的内部状态和实现细节,提高代码的可维护性和可读性。28.【答案】在SQL数据库中,索引是一种数据结构,用于加速对数据库表中数据的查找和检索。索引的作用包括:
1.加速查询:通过索引,数据库可以快速定位到数据所在的位置,从而提高查询效率。
2.维护数据完整性:索引可以确保数据的唯一性,防止重复数据的插入。
3.支持排序和分组操作:索引可以用于对数据进行排序和分组,这在执行某些类型的查询时非常有用。
索引的类型包括:B树索引、哈希索引、全文索引等,每种索引都有其适用的场景和特点。【解析】索引是数据库优化的重要手段,正确选择和使用索引可以显著提高数据库的性能。29.【答案】在Linux系统中,可以使用pip工具来安装Python包。以下是使用pip安装Python包的基本步骤:
1.确保Python环境已经安装pip,如果没有,可以使用系统包管理器进行安装,如使用apt-get(对于基于Debian的系统)或yum(对于基于RPM的系统)。
2.打开终端。
3.使用pipinstall命令后跟包名来安装所需的Python包,例如:pipinstallnumpy。
4.安装过程中,pip会自动下载包的源代码,编译安装,并配置环境变量。【解析】pip是Python的一个包管理工具,它简化了Python包的安装和管理过程,是Python开发者常用的工具之一。30.【答案】在JavaScript中,事件监听器是用于处理用户交互(如点击、鼠标移动等)的一种机制。以下是如何使用事件监听器的步骤:
1
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025企业租赁合同简易模板
- 转科交接登记制度
- 颈椎病门诊病历模板范文
- 2025年滨河小学考试题目及答案
- 2025年民生保障考试题目及答案
- 2025内蒙古赤峰市翁牛特旗富兴投资管理有限公司所属子公司员工招聘笔试及笔试历年典型考点题库附带答案详解2套试卷
- 财税人员面试题及答案
- 槽错租赁合同
- 2025中国广播电视网络有限公司高校毕业生招聘考试历年高频难点与易错点集合带答案解析(3卷合一)
- 墙面装饰合同
- 2025-2030年储能行业供应链整合与创新应用分析报告
- 2025入团积极分子结业考试题库(含答案)
- 2025-2026学年北京市昌平区八年级英语上册期中考试试卷及答案
- 南京公积金贷款协议书
- 现场救护安全培训总结课件
- DB32∕ 4149-2021 水泥工业大气污染物排放标准
- 重阳节及课件
- 佣金合同范本英文模板
- 六年级上册美术课件-第8课 字体的变化丨赣美版
- 涂装污水处理工程设计技术方案
- 《员工手册修订》word版
评论
0/150
提交评论